Professor Peter Doherty and Judith Pead at the Lucia Ball
From 1996 until 1998 Judith Patricia Pead was the Australian Ambassador to the Kingdom of Sweden, with non-resident accreditations to the Kingdom of Norway and to the Republics of Estonia, Finland, Iceland, Latvia and Lithuania.
